Adhesiveness : (noun) 1: the property of sticking together (as of glue and wood) or
the joining of surfaces of different composition [syn: adhesion,
adherence, bond]

Adhesiveness : \Ad*he"sive*ness\, n.
1. The quality of sticking or adhering; stickiness; tenacity
of union.
2. (Phren.) Propensity to form and maintain attachments to
persons, and to promote social intercourse.
